Creating a website isn’t particularly hard, especially with platforms like WordPress and Shopify available. But when it comes to integrating advanced functionalities or creating something like an eCommerce website, professional expertise would be more beneficial.

Forget the days of struggling with website builders or relying on luck to find the right web development company. The top web development companies offer teams of skilled professionals who can take your vision from concept to reality. That ensures your website not only looks great but also drives results.

So, what are some other benefits of hiring a web development company? Well, we’ll look at that. But first, let’s see what a web development company is, what it does, and how you can choose the best one?

What is a Web Development Company?

A web development company specializes in creating and maintaining websites and web applications for clients. These companies typically consist of a team of professionals with expertise in various aspects of web development, including web designers, front-end developers, back-end developers, and sometimes digital marketers.

The primary goal of a web development company is to help clients establish a strong online presence. They help businesses achieve their specific objectives through effective and user-friendly websites.

Key Services Offered by a Web Development Company

  • Website Design: Creating visually appealing and user-friendly website layouts.
  • Front-End Development: Implementing the client-side or user interface of a website using technologies such as HTML, CSS, and JavaScript.
  • Back-End Development: Building the server-side and database components of a website, often using languages like PHP, Python, Ruby, or Node.js.
  • Full-Stack Development: Involves working on both the front-end and back-end aspects of a website or application.
  • eCommerce Development: Building online stores and integrating secure payment systems for businesses that sell products or services online.
  • Content Management System (CMS) Development: Creating custom CMS solutions or working with existing platforms like WordPress, Drupal, or Joomla.
  • Web Application Development: Developing dynamic web applications that may involve complex functionalities and interactivity.
  • Maintenance and Support: Providing ongoing support, updates, and maintenance services for websites and web applications.

A good web development company should offer all of these services with all the necessary skills and resources. That will help the client leverage the power of the internet to reach their target audience and achieve success in the digital realm.

But what are the benefits of hiring a web development company? Let’s see.

What are the Benefits of Hiring a Web Development Company?

Hiring a web development company has many advantages. Expert professionals build and optimize your website for success. That makes it user-friendly and gives it smooth navigation and efficient functioning. Plus, you get continual support and maintenance.

Let’s look at the benefits in detail.

  • Technical prowess: Web developers possess the skills and knowledge to create websites that are not only visually appealing but also technically sound, secure, and optimized for performance. This saves you the time and effort of learning complex coding languages and frameworks.
  • Strategic guidance: Experienced developers understand the latest trends and best practices in web design and development. They can offer valuable insights and recommendations tailored to your specific business goals and target audience.
  • Faster turnaround times: Dedicated teams can work efficiently to deliver your website within your desired timeframe, allowing you to focus on other aspects of your business.
  • User-friendly interfaces: Web developers can create intuitive and engaging websites that provide a seamless user experience, leading to higher conversion rates and improved brand perception.
  • Mobile-friendliness: In today’s mobile-first world, developers ensure your website is optimized for various screen sizes and devices, reaching a wider audience and improving accessibility.
  • Search engine optimization (SEO): Developers can implement SEO best practices to improve your website’s ranking in search engine results pages (SERPs), increasing organic traffic and leads.
  • Focus on core business: Outsourcing web development frees up your internal resources to concentrate on your core business activities, potentially leading to increased productivity and efficiency.
  • Access to specialized skills: You gain access to a team of professionals with diverse skill sets. That includes designers, programmers, content creators, and marketing specialists, without the need to hire and manage them yourself.
  • Scalability: Web development companies can easily adapt and scale their services to meet your evolving needs, whether it’s adding new features, integrating third-party tools, or managing increased traffic.
  • Proactive maintenance: Developers ensure your website is secure, up-to-date, and running smoothly, preventing downtime and potential security breaches.
  • Technical support: You have access to ongoing technical support and troubleshooting assistance, ensuring your website is always functioning optimally.

Ultimately, hiring from the top web development agencies can be a strategic investment that unlocks your website’s full potential. It enhances the online presence and drives business growth. But that is only possible if you get the best service provider for your project. How do you do that? Let’s see.

How to Choose the Best Web Development Company?

Choosing the most suitable web development company is a crucial decision that can significantly impact the success of your online presence. Here are some key factors to consider when selecting a web development company:

  • Goals and Requirements: Clearly outline your project goals, features, and specific requirements. Knowing what you need will help you identify a company with expertise in the relevant technologies and services.
  • Portfolio and Experience: Review the company’s portfolio to assess their previous work. Look for projects similar to yours in terms of complexity and industry. A company with relevant experience is more likely to understand your needs and deliver a successful project.
  • Technical Expertise: Ensure that the web development company has the technical expertise required for your project. This includes proficiency in programming languages, frameworks, and technologies relevant to your website or application.
  • Client Reviews and Testimonials: Check client reviews and testimonials to gauge the satisfaction of previous clients. Platforms like Clutch, Google Reviews, or the company’s website can provide insights into their reputation and the quality of their services.
  • Communication and Collaboration: Effective communication is crucial for a successful project. Assess the company’s communication processes, responsiveness, and willingness to collaborate. A company that values transparent communication can better understand and meet your expectations.
  • Scalability and Future Support: Consider the scalability of the solutions provided by the company. Ensure they can accommodate future growth and expansion. Additionally, inquire about their post-launch support and maintenance services.
  • Cost and Budget: Request detailed project proposals and pricing estimates from multiple web development companies. Be cautious of unusually low quotes, as they may indicate a lack of quality or hidden costs. Choose a company that provides a balance between quality and affordability.
  • Timeline and Project Management: Discuss the expected timeline for your project and the company’s approach to project management. A reliable web development company should provide a realistic timeline and keep you informed about the progress throughout the development process.
  • Security Measures: Inquire about the security measures implemented by the company to protect your website and user data. Security should be a top priority, and the company should have protocols in place to address potential vulnerabilities.
  • Legal and Contractual Aspects: Review the terms of the contract, including deliverables, payment schedules, and any legal considerations. Ensure that you have a clear understanding of the contractual agreement before moving forward.

Make sure you evaluate these factors clearly to understand which company would be the most suitable for your web project. That company will be able to provide you with all the top benefits you are looking for.


Hiring a web development firm reaps many advantages. Their knowledge of website creation and design can improve a business’s online presence. Plus, they can make sure websites are user-friendly, attractive, and optimized for search engines. Outsourcing web development also allows businesses to focus on their core functions, saving time and resources.

Furthermore, these firms offer ongoing maintenance and support services. This ensures that websites are functional and up-to-date. They can take care of technical issues quickly and efficiently, avoiding any downtime. With their industry experience, they know the latest trends and technologies, which helps improve website performance.

So, want professional help with your web project? Then our recommendations for the web development companies would be of help.

FAQs on Benefits of Hiring Web Development Company

1. How can a web development company improve my website’s functionality?

A web development company has extensive experience in developing websites with enhanced functionalities. They can integrate various tools, plugins, and features that improve user experience. These include e-commerce capabilities, responsive design for mobile devices, advanced search functions, and secure payment gateways.

2. Can a web development company help me with website maintenance?

Yes, a professional web development company offers ongoing maintenance and support for your website. They can regularly update your website’s software, plugins, and security measures to ensure it remains secure and functional. This saves you time and ensures your website stays up-to-date and free of technical issues.

Neil Jordan
Hey! I'm Neil Jordan, a technical consultant with extensive experience in web development, design, and technical solution management. My research focuses on web development and various technologies. I have a diverse background in providing various IT service consulting.

